Starting in the fall of 2026, Easthaven Baptist Church will partner with Southeastern Baptist Theological Seminary through the Equip Network to provide graduate-level theological education directly in the context of the local church.

Students can pursue a Master of Arts in Christian Ministry or a Bachelor of Arts in Christian Ministry while taking in-person and online classes together.

 

Interested in how the program works at Easthaven?

Students in the program will:

  1. Apply and enroll as a student at Southeastern Seminary.

  2. Participate in Equip courses hosted through Easthaven.

  3. Complete additional coursework online through Southeastern Seminary.

The program allows students to remain rooted in their local church while receiving accredited seminary training.

  • The MA and BA in Christian Ministry are designed for those who want to serve in ministry leadership roles, such as:

    • Church staff members

    • Ministry directors or coordinators

    • Non-profit ministry leaders

    • Church planters or missionaries

    • Lay leaders who want deeper theological training

    The degree combines seminary coursework with local church mentorship, allowing students to learn while actively serving in ministry.

    Students complete coursework through a mix of:

    • Equip courses hosted at Easthaven and taught in person

    • Online courses through Southeastern Seminary

    • Mentored ministry experience

  • All courses, including Equip, cost the normal rate of tuition:

    • Seminary - Southern Baptist rate: $322 per credit hour + student enrollment fee

    • Seminary - Standard tuition rate: $430 per credit hour + student enrollment fee

    • College - Southern Baptist rate: $417 per credit hour + student enrollment fee

    • College - Standard tuition rate: $554 per credit hour + student enrollment fee
